Fix a bug where the IME pre-edit would desync from Zed (#12651)
fixes #11829 In https://github.com/zed-industries/zed/pull/7494, we introduced IME event buffering, so that we could preempt the IME with a keystroke event in some cases. However, this caused a desynchronization bug in long multi-step IME composition, such as the pre-edit used in the Japanese Romaji keyboard (and other languages). We found that this was due to the IME issuing actions, and then immediately querying the editor's state before we had applied those actions. Therefore, this PR removes IME action buffering. We have tested all of the cases in the `handle_key_event` documentation and added a few of our own.
